Preparation
Combine the eggs with the cream, seasoning with salt and pepper.
Drain and crumble the tuna, and add it to the previous mixture. Roll out the pie crust in your tart pan, and pour this mixture into it.
Slice the tomatoes, and arrange them on top of the quiche. Sprinkle with herbs de Provence.
Bake for 35 minutes at 350°F (180°C).
And there you have it, your tuna and tomato quiche is ready!

What makes this tuna and tomato quiche a quick meal option?
The quiche is quick to prepare, taking only 10 minutes of prep time and 35 minutes to cook, making it a total of 45 minutes from start to finish.
Can I use fresh tuna instead of canned for this quiche?
Yes, you can use fresh tuna, but ensure it is cooked properly before adding it to the mixture for the best flavor and texture.
What can I serve with tuna and tomato quiche for a balanced meal?
A mixed salad pairs perfectly with the quiche, providing a fresh and nutritious complement to the dish.
Is it possible to make this quiche 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the quiche in advance and store it in the refrigerator. Just reheat it before serving for the best taste.
What variations can I try with the ingredients in this quiche?
You can experiment with different vegetables like spinach or bell peppers, or add cheese for extra flavor, making it versatile to your taste preferences.
